The Concrete Advancement Network (CAN) recently held its Closed Industry Advisory Board (IAB) Spring Project Review and Idea Ranking Session, chaired by Sam Lines, with Trevor Towery serving as vice chair. The meeting aimed to assess the progress and future potential of ongoing projects, review new proposals, and strategize upcoming initiatives. Four ongoing projects were evaluated, each demonstrating solid progress. The meeting also included discussions on funding philosophy, emphasizing the selection of impactful projects aligned with short-, medium-, and long-term goals. Additionally, 17 newly submitted project ideas were reviewed and ranked by industry partners to identify key priority topics. Plans were also outlined for the upcoming September meeting in Oregon.
